diff --git a/src/RegonSoapClient.php b/src/RegonSoapClient.php index 69bb303..d37adb0 100644 --- a/src/RegonSoapClient.php +++ b/src/RegonSoapClient.php @@ -74,10 +74,12 @@ public function __doRequest($request, $location, $action, $version, $oneWay = 0) $hdr->appendChild(new DOMElement('To', $location, 'http://www.w3.org/2005/08/addressing')); $dom->documentElement->insertBefore($hdr, $dom->documentElement->firstChild); $request = $dom->saveXML(); - $response = parent::__doRequest($request, $location, $action, $version, $oneWay); - $response = stristr(stristr($response, '', true) . ''; + if ($response = parent::__doRequest($request, $location, $action, $version, $oneWay)) { + $response = stristr(stristr($response, '', true) . ''; + return $response; + } - return $response; + return ''; } /**